- The distance between Fairmont, Mn, Usa and Miri, Malaysia is approximately 13,957 km or 8,673 mi.
- To reach Fairmont, Mn in this distance one would set out from Miri bearing 24.5°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Fairmont, Mn bearing 144.9° or SE .
- Fairmont, Mn has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Miri has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- The mean annual temperature is 19.2 °C (34.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 31.5 °C (56.7°F) more in Fairmont, Mn.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2066.1 mm (81.3 in) less which is equivalent to 2066.1 l/m² (50.71 US gal/ft²) or 20,661,000 l/ha (2,208,798 US gal/ac) less. About 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 28.5° lower in Fairmont, Mn than in Miri.
